SIXTEEN
BROOKE
Iknocked on Judeâs front door at quarter to six, refusing to let myself fall into a pit of despair and jealousy. Yesterday, when heâd told me heâd arranged a date for tonight, it felt like my stomach plummeted out of my body.
Once again, he was headed out on a date. Charming and funny and kind Jude found yet another willing woman, while I couldnât even find a guy who was interested in me past a few conversations. Not that Iâd been trying very hard. Not since my disaster of a date weeks ago and what happened after with Jude on the couch of my farmhouse.
So, yeah, I was a jealous shrew.
Jealous that he matched up a storm of women, while I had not had the same luck.
Not to mention, I was jealous of whoever this woman was, who so easily made Jude forget about what happened between us. Not once or twice, but three times!
Sex was a big deal for me, and I knew Jude planned on sowing his wild oats or whatever, but it had never occurred to me to go back to the app to find a match. That he would go back to the app.
So maybe, for a minute or two, Iâd become disoriented by my delusion, believing what had happened between us meant something more for him too, butâ¦
I slapped on a smile and volunteered myself to babysit. Because I was a mature adult and Judeâs friend. And I could be happy for him.
âI get it! I get it!â Amelia shouted a moment before she swung the door wide open. âHi!â
âHey, girlfriend.â I rubbed her back when she threw herself around my leg, hugging me tight, along with Small Unicorn. âDaddy said youâre gonna stay with us tonight!â
âI am. You happy?â
She nodded, practically vibrating.
âMe too.â
âWill you play Go Fish?â
I bent down to her level, telling her seriously, âI would love to play Go Fish with you.â
âYes!â She took off, sliding on the wood floor with her socks on. âIâmma get them!â
I closed the door behind me, poking my head around the wall to the dining room, finding it cluttered with backpacks, toys, papers, and shoes. Walking into the kitchen, I spotted Sebastian over the pass-through, lounged out on the couch in the living room as Amelia tossed pillows around, on the hunt for her Go Fish cards.
âHey, Seb.â
He briefly turned to me and waved before going back to his handheld gaming system.
âFound it!â Amelia raced toward me, smacking into my legs. âSee? See? Itâs-itâs-itâs fish. All different fish! Whatâs your favorite fish?â
âHm. I donât know. No one has ever asked me before.â
âSwordfish? Starfish? Seahorse?â she guessed rapid-fire.
âYeah, maybe seahorse. Whatâsâ ââ
âHey.â
I spun around as Jude entered the kitchen, tugging at the collar of his short-sleeved black button-down. With his hair slicked back, his beard trimmed, and his sun-kissed tan, he looked⦠Well, he looked hot.
He held his arms out for my inspection and, as if to rub it in, asked, âWhat do you think?â
I deliberately dragged my gaze over his body.
